Overview

#7A4D76 is a warm, dark color. In RGB it is 122, 77, 118, in HSL 305.3°, 22.6%, 39.0%, and in CMYK 0.0%, 36.9%, 3.3%, 52.2%. The nearest named color is RAL 4005 Blue Lilac.

Color Psychology

Magenta is a stimulating, attention-commanding color that bridges passion and imagination. It represents transformation, artistic vision, and unconventional thinking. Magenta disrupts expectations and is associated with innovation and bold self-expression.

Design Usage

Medium magentas are powerful for brands that want to project creativity and boldness. They create eye-catching gradients when blended with purple or orange tones. Use sparingly as accent colors for maximum impact in otherwise restrained designs.
